Help us reduce traffic and improve air quality on Long Island by joining the Fall 2012 Carpool Challenge. In addition to rewards for employees who step up to the challenge by carpooling, local businesses will receive some much deserved recognition. 

If you accept our Fall Carpool Challenge, each participating employee who completes as few as 4 carpool roundtrips to work during one calendar month between October to December will receive a $25 TARGET gift card. Plus, the organization with the largest number of participating carpoolers will win a free luncheon as a special reward.

Ridesharing saves money and fuel. Even a small increase in the number of carpoolers will remarkably reduce traffic congestion and parking problems. It will also make a big difference in the air we breathe, the water we drink and the entire environment we live and work in by reducing vehicle emissions.

511NY Rideshare is a vital feature of the free to the user 511NY system that is building a smarter, multimodal transportation network coordinating road, train and bus information. 511NY Rideshare is a public service sponsored by the New York State Department of Transportation.
